The school has gone to incredible lengths to hamstring this event, including:
1 – Forcing us to change our ticketing system the day of the event. The university’s excuse is they want to ensure “fair and equitable” ticketing. This means the hundreds of students who thought they had tickets will not get in. This has never happened at one of our events.
2 – Protester groups were somehow tipped off about the school’s new ticketing system and the timing of when they’d be made available, allowing them to reserve large numbers of tickets to stage a walk out. We know this because our students are also in those group chats and alerted us. This also has never happened before.
3 – We had thousands of people register for tickets to this event, but the school would only give us a venue with 330 seat. No overflow. No larger venue.
4 – Our chapter president has been doxxed with his number and address published on social media. The campus police and school administrator shrugged their shoulders.
5 – The administration has said they cannot step in or ask protesters to leave if they attempt to disrupt the event or shout down Kyle.
6 – The school has allowed into the event the student that doxxed our chapter president, knowing this person was responsible for the doxxing.
7 – The protestors have entered the event and are taping the names of the people involved in Kyle Rittenhouse’s legal defense. The school is not stopping them.
